The first step is to determine the type and amount of protection you require. A gated apartment complex might require 24/7 coverage, whereas a retail store might require only an attendant during business hours. For residential areas, it might involve checking visitors, CCTV monitoring, and controlling deliveries. For companies, you might need someone to control crowds, monitor entry-exit records, or control access control systems. Having a clear description of your security requirements will guide you in eliminating the kind of guard needed — armed or unarmed, static or patrol. You can either hire directly or through an accredited agency. Independent hiring appears to be budget-friendly, but it is risky. You are in a position to handle background checks, training, insurance, and compliance with the law. If you hire through a recognised agency, you are normally free of these responsibilities. The guard is screened, trained, insured, and allocated according to your needs. In India, the Private Security Agencies Regulation Act (PSARA), 2005, governs the activities of security firms. Make sure the hiring agency is licensed by PSARA if you are using one. The security guard needs to have received training in compliance with state regulations if you are hiring them directly. Always check for identity documents, police clearance certificates, and training certificates before you hire a private security guard. Whether you’re hiring through an agency or independently, always conduct a personal background check. Cross-verify references. If the guard claims previous experience, try contacting past employers. Don’t rely entirely on the paperwork. Face-to-face interaction is equally important. Look out for discipline, confidence, and communication skills during the interview. Fees for private guards differ based on location, expertise, and risk levels. Security guards in metro cities charge between ₹15,000 to ₹25,000 for home services per month. Armed personnel or those with specific training may cost more. When you hire a private security guard, check that the salary covers statutory requirements such as ESI, PF, and gratuity if they apply. Ask who pays for uniforms, transportation, or gadgets. Regardless of our method of hiring, through an agency or directly, a written contract must be created. It must have: Duty scope and working hours Salary, method of payment, and benefits Code of ethics and disciplinary conditions Liabilities and duties in case of an accident Terms of dismissal This agreement will safeguard you legally in the event of any conflict. Once you hire a private security guard, ensure they are provided with the right gear — a cell phone, flashlight, sign-in for visitor records, and whichever communication tool is integrated with CCTV, if necessary. Continual performance evaluation is crucial; keep checking on punctuality, vigilance, and behaviour. In case you have a business, give a supervisor the responsibility to manage security functions. Even professional guards might fail in actual emergency situations. Provide regular drills, particularly if your business or home experiences high traffic. Educate them to respond during medical emergencies, fires, or unauthorised entries. A properly trained guard is not only a deterrent but can be a saviour in emergency situations.
